You've got the keys from your landlord, moved into your new home, and the boxes are unpacked. Now you want to put your stamp on the place, but how do you do this when you can't paint the walls, refurbish the kitchen or replace the old, tired flooring?
And can you really live with magnolia walls? What about those outdated kitchen cupboards? Not to mention the tattered lampshades, old sofa and sparse furniture...
In this invaluable book, award-winning interiors blogger Medina Grillo shares her favourite tips, tricks and DIY projects for transforming a rented space. Discover ways to add a splash of colour with removable wallpaper, learn how to hang artworks without damaging the walls, and turn your hand to upcycling those furniture bargains you picked up at the flea market.
With chapters covering all aspects of the home, from walls, flooring and lighting to storage and accessories, Home Sweet Home will enable every reader to make their house feel like home, whether they are a DIY expert or have never before lifted a paintbrush.
Filled with photography and illustrations, and featuring a brand new introduction in this new edition, it is the perfect read for any renter looking to live in a beautiful and stylish home.
